Abstract
Transport regulators are examining the feasibility of requiring the adoption of takeoff performance monitoring systems in certain circumstances. Recent advances in the development of aircraft landing and takeoff performance monitoring systems have shown the feasibility of a cockpit instrument that could aid significantly in the decision making process during the most critical phases of flight, provided that the information can be effectively visualized. The design and construction of a cockpit interface to communicate the information in a timely and efficient manner has now been completed. The resulting Thrust and Braking Indicator/Advisor (TABI/A) integrates a visual display with audible advice.
